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
173303 4066 164766
00894797 6119
00894797 6119
612235 588972624 172318106 39486378
All about undefined
Interested in learning more?
00894797 6119
612235 588972624 172318106 39486378
See more
4581965517 186509936 71405891756
39618484 290485 9999161 84 72468465
See more
33 30999304182
257 94 1897
See more